I think v$db_pipes may be the thing
you're after.

I am trying to install a vendor application with an Oracle repository = and not making much progress. The install has failed and the cleanup = requires that the pipe be purged and removed or the database be bounced. = I've been through this four times since Friday afternoon. I can't find = any way to view whether or not a pipe exists. I know its not a = conventional database object and that its some sort of memory structure. =  Is there a way to do this? Where do I look?
